Description

Journey upwards with Cliffhanger, a dizzyingly beautiful presentation of the people and places that make up the world of climbing. Climbing has recently exploded as a global phenomenon, thanks to a plethora of dedicated gyms springing up and media coverage that has had a wide reach. Using breathtaking imagery and in-depth stories, Cliffhanger gives you a complete look at the world of this outdoor pursuit--both as a sport and a lifestyle--by highlighting the people, places, history, and culture that make the activity so fascinating. Whether you've been doing it for a long time or have never climbed in your life, this book will make your palms sweat and your heart race.

Author Biography:

Julie Ellison has spent 10 years writing, shooting, and editing stories about the vertical world. She was Climbing magazine's first female editor-in--chief before starting the all-woman film-production company Never Not Collective. She lives with her dog at the base of the Tetons, Wyoming.
